    if Usenet is not what you want - I switched months ago don't know why I torrented so long ; was on the torrent bandwagon from beginning ; usenet download 350 MB tv show 3 1/2 minutes vs torrent @ fastest DL speed = 1/2 hr.

    a possibility is switching to a business connection which includes basic TV ,i.e. Shaw cable currently offering extreme speed 15/1MBps for $49.95 not enforcing bandwidth limits or aggressively shaping traffic. (residential ExtremeSpeed is $56 + mo) ; maybe Rogers has similar Policies with Business connections

    otherwise a torrent friendly VPN with no logging is your most economical and secure solution
